Danny Bowen Obituary

Danny Allen Bowen

January 30, 1947 - September 30, 2025

Danny Allen Bowen, age 78, of Council Bluffs, passed away September 30, 2025, at CHI-Mercy Hospital. Danny was born January 30, 1947, in Omaha, Neb., to the late Bert and Helen (Bills) Bowen, and graduated from Thomas Jefferson High School with the class of 1965.

Danny proudly served in the US Navy and was united in marriage to Julie Arrick on June 28, 1969. To this union, daughter, Suzanne and son, Patrick were born.

Danny worked for over 35 years for the Union Pacific Railroad, retiring in 1997 as a Yardmaster. His hobbies included homing pigeons, in which he started as a youngster, and horse racing with brother Bill. He was a trendsetter in fishing and hunting, the king of 1,000 hobbies, and most of all, loved his family and friends.

In addition to his parents, Danny is preceded in death by his sisters, Helen Manley and husband, Ed, Myrna Edson and husband, Dan; nephew, Jay Edson; sister-in-law, Bev Bowen.

Danny is survived by his wife of 56 years, Julie Bowen; daughter, Suzanne "Sue" Bowen and Kevin Allely; son, Patrick Bowen and wife, Kimberly; grandchildren, Morgan Bowen and wife, Racquel, Kallie Reeves and husband, Preston; great-grandchildren, Ivy and Mabel; step-grandchildren, Jaimee, Julie Ann, Brooklynn, and Austin; a host of great-grandchildren; brother, Billy Bowen; and nieces and nephews.

Visitation, Sunday, 1 to 4 p.m. Funeral service, Monday, 10:30 a.m., all at Cutler-O'Neill-Meyer-Woodring, Bayliss Park Chapel.

Danny will be laid to rest in Ridgewood Cemetery, followed by a luncheon at Corpus Christi Church, 3304 4th Avenue, in Council Bluffs.
